Guest Wayne in Malvern PA Posted May 29, 2006 Share Posted May 29, 2006 I bought the cockpit cover California Car Cover sells for the TC. Certainly seems to be custom cut and fits perfectly. Three tabs fit under the trunk lid, velcro straps go around the mirrors, elastic straps hook under the door handles, front held in place by the windshield wipers. Looks pretty good as well. Seems like it was under $60.00.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
